Postby James__SIU » February 13th, 2016, 5:22 pm

SIU beat Drake 75-60. Not that any other valley game really matters today after what the panthers pulled off earlier today...the one thing I'll say about the Salukis win is it is the best execution of a coaches game plan I've seen all year for SIU. Wouldn't let Drake get an uncontested 3. The Drake bigs had good games and the backdoor play was there quite a few times but they shot 7% from 3 and Timmer was shut down. I think that is pretty good considering Drake was the best 3 shooting team in the valley going into today.
